House raising services involve elevating a residential property to address various concerns such as flooding, foundation issues, or structural damage. The process typically includes carefully lifting the entire structure off its foundation, often with specialized equipment, and then placing it on a new or reinforced foundation. This technique allows for modifications to the existing foundation, such as raising the home above flood levels or repairing compromised footings, without the need for complete demolition. House raising can be a complex operation that requires careful planning and execution to ensure the stability and safety of the structure throughout the process.

This service helps resolve problems associated with flood-prone areas, especially in regions where rising water levels threaten homes. It is also used to correct foundation settlement or deterioration, which can cause uneven floors, cracked walls, or compromised structural integrity. House raising can prevent future water damage, reduce the risk of structural failure, and improve the overall safety of a property. Additionally, elevating a home may open opportunities for basement conversions or other renovations that require a higher foundation level, making it a practical solution for homeowners facing specific structural challenges.

Cost Range - House raising services typically cost between $10,000 and $50,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, raising a small home might be around $12,000, while larger or more complex structures could reach $45,000 or more.

Factors Affecting Cost - The total expense varies based on foundation type, home size, and local labor rates. Additional costs may include permits, utilities, and structural reinforcements, which can add several thousand dollars to the overall budget.

Average Price Considerations - On average, homeowners in Loganville, WI, might spend approximately $20,000 to $35,000 for house raising services. Costs tend to increase with added features like custom foundation work or extensive structural modifications.

Cost Variability - Prices for house raising services can vary widely depending on the project's scope and location. It is common for costs to fluctuate by several thousand dollars based on specific requirements and contractor est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
